Limb Pruning in Reno, NV
Limb pruning services involve selectively removing specific branches or limbs from trees to improve their overall health, appearance, and safety. This process is suitable for a variety of projects, including removing dead or diseased branches, reducing the size of overgrown limbs, shaping trees for aesthetic reasons, or preventing potential hazards caused by weak or damaged branches. Homeowners often seek limb pruning to maintain the safety of their property, promote healthy growth, and enhance the visual appeal of their landscape.
Before requesting limb pruning, property owners typically want to understand which parts of their trees will be affected, the best timing for pruning, and how the process can benefit the tree's longevity. It is also common to inquire about the recommended frequency of pruning and any potential impacts on nearby structures or utilities. Clear communication about the scope of work ensures that the pruning aligns with the homeowner’s goals and maintains the health and safety of the trees.

Common Limb Pruning Jobs
Tree pruning - selective trimming to improve tree health and appearance.
Crown thinning - reducing branch density to allow more light and air flow.
Structural pruning - shaping trees to promote strong branch development.
Deadwood removal - eliminating dead or diseased branches to prevent decay.
Formative pruning - shaping young trees for proper growth and structure.
Safety pruning - removing hazardous branches near structures or power lines.
Limb Pruning Questions
What is limb pruning? Limb pruning involves selectively removing or trimming branches to improve tree health and structure.
Why is limb pruning important? It helps prevent hazards, promotes healthy growth, and maintains the appearance of trees on the property.
When should limb pruning be done? Pruning is best performed during dormancy or when specific branches show signs of damage or disease.
What types of trees benefit from limb pruning? Most deciduous and evergreen trees can benefit, especially those with overgrown or crossing branches.
